Robert C.
Brown formerly worked at Kraton Polymers LLC, as Director, General Electric Co., as President-Sealants & Adhesives, W.
R.
Grace & Co.-Conn., as Vice President, and GE Silicones, Inc., as President.
Mr. Brown received his undergraduate degree from Plymouth State University.

W. R. Grace & Co.-Conn.
W. R. Grace & Co.-Conn. Chemicals: Major DiversifiedProcess Industries W.R. Grace & Co. engages in the production and sale of chemicals and materials. It operates through the Grace Catalysts Technologies and Grace Materials Technologies segments. The Grace Catalysts Technologies segment includes catalysts and related products and technologies used in refining, petrochemical and other chemical manufacturing applications. The Grace Materials Technologies segment consists of specialty materials, including silica-based and silica-alumina-based materials, used in coatings, consumer, industrial, and pharmaceutical applications. The firm specializes in chemical processing, coatings and inks, food and beverage, general industrial, nutraceutical, personal care, pharma, and plastics industries. The company was founded by William Russell Grace in 1854 and is headquartered in Columbia, MD. | Process Industries |
